Glycerin was discovered in 1778 by Scheele, ele, who obtained it in the preparation of lead plaster by saponifying lard with oxides of lead. Glycerin occurs in most natural animal and vegetable fats in combination with fatty acids, from which it can be obtained by saponifying with alkalies. It is also formed during the alcoholic fermentation of sugar. Pure glycerin is obtained by heating neutral fats in still, with a condensing apparatus, and passing steam in the melted fat, the temperature being kept below 600° F., and above 550° F.; the fat acids separate out in the receivers from the glycerin and water; the glycerin is then concenglycerin trated by evaporation. Glycerin is a thick, colorless, inodorous, neutral syrup, which has a very sweet taste; it mixes with water in all proportions, is soluble in alcohol and in chloroform, but insoluble in ether. Glycerin distilled with phosphorous pentachloride, P₂Cls, yields acrolein. By the action of a mixture of equal parts of concentrated nitric acid and sulphuric acid, it is converted into NITROGLYCERIN, CH₂O (NO₂) CHO (NO₂)CH2O (NO2) (q. v.). Glycerin is used for preserving fruits, also as a solvent for various salts, and in preparing copying-ink; also as a lubricator for machinery and and clockwork, and is placed over water in gas meters to prevent freezing, and is used for filling floating compasses. It is employed in the form of nitroglycerin in the preparation of dynamite, and for mixing with soap to form glycerin soap, which tends to soften the skin. Glycerin is used on account of its physical properties as an adjunct to lotions in the surface beskin diseases to prevent coming dry. It can be used as a substitute for sugar in the diet of diabetic patients.

glis'er-in, a transparent, colorless liquid with the sweet taste and appearance of a sirup. Specific gravity 1.27. It is obtained from beef and other fats, notably palm oil, by the action of super-heated steam. Commercially it is a by-product in the manufacture of stearin candles. It consists of carbon, hydrogen, and oxygen, which, it may be remembered, is also the composition of alcohol. It mixes well with water and cannot be fermented. It freezes, but not readily, into white crystals. It is used in medicine to soften and soothe a sore throat, for instance. Glycerin salves, soaps, and cosmetics are excellent toilet articles, especially for chapped hands, rough face, or sores. As a salve it is particularly excellent. The reason is a simple one. Instead of drying up, glycerin attracts moisture from the air. Like alcohol and sirup, glycerin is fatal to the growth of bacteria, and may be used as a preservative for animal and plant substances. It is an important part of the explosive nitroglycerin. It is also used in the preparation of mucilage, in sizing paper, and in many manufactures. Glycerin is used as a remedy for nervous diseases and neuralgia. In order to obviate the objection to alcoholic medicines many remedies are compounded with glycerin. Since 1906 Ayer's Sarsaparilla, for instance, has been put up in a solution of glycerin instead of alcohol.
